Eastman Chemical Company (NYSE: EMN) manufactures
and markets chemicals, fibers and plastics. Key products include coatings, adhesives, specialty plastics, cellulose acetate fibers, polyethylene terephthalate polymers for packaging, and intermediates based on oxo and acetyl chemistries. The company has operations in 23 countries and employees 11,000. Dow Chemical (NYSE: DOW) is a major competitor.
Eastman surprised investors earlier in the week, when it issued upside guidance for first quarter earnings. The firm now sees Q1 EPS of $1.30, versus the Street consensus estimate of $1.21. Management said that continued strong sales volume and higher selling prices offset higher raw material and energy costs.
